These things I have spoken to you, that in Me you may have peace. In the world you will have tribulation; but be of good cheer, I have overcome the world.”
John 16:33 NKJV
OUR text is the Lord's last statement to the apostles before He prayed and went into passion. If only we can hold unto it, our life will be tremendously blessed. No matter what we face in life, the Lord has overcome for us already! Glory! The Lord said, "Your father Abraham rejoiced to see My day, and he saw it and was glad.”
(John 8:56 NKJV)
How did Abraham see it? By faith. We should also live His days by the faith of Jesus who has overcome the world for us. Hebrews 11:13 NIV says, "All these people were still living by faith when they died. They did not receive the things promised; they only saw them and welcomed them from a distance, admitting that they were foreigners and strangers on earth."
Imagine the faith Abraham has, though rich, yet lived like a pilgrim, and joyfully welcomed God's promises from a distance. That's Why the Lord wants us to be courageous, "For our light and momentary troubles are achieving for us an eternal glory that far outweighs them all. So we fix our eyes not on what is seen, but on what is unseen, since what is seen is temporary, but what is unseen is eternal." (2 Corinthians 4:17-18 NIV)
